What will your job look like? The
Member Travel Agent is responsible for sourcing, organizing, booking, tracking, and handling member travel requests for all plans. This role will ensure that all travel needs are met within the constraints of the plan/program and budget.
The
Member Travel Agent is required to have knowledge of commonly used concepts, software, practices, and procedures within the customer service and hospitality fields, and rely on instructions and pre-established plan and guidelines to perform the functions of the job.
Location: Remote (hybrid of 2 days a week if within 40 miles of an MTM office). Hours: Monday - Friday: 8:00am - 4:30pm CST Monday - Friday: 10:00am - 6:30pm HST (2:00pm - 10:30pm CST) What you'll do: - Ensure 100% plan and company compliance
- Verify appointments prior to trip setting per plan requirements
- Obtain all pertinent prior authorization forms from the health plan(s) for approval/denial of request
- Ensure lodging and airfare purchases are made with MTM preferred partners or other reputable vendors that will provide the highest value and cost effectiveness
- Ensure procurement of travel services by company credit card follow PCI compliance guidelines
- Obtain, complete, and distribute credit card authorization as needed for lodging procurement
- Manage the storage and accessibility of invoices related to all travel procurement
- Negotiate discounts with new hotels, set up direct bills, and ensure incidentals are deactivated when applicable
- Complete all data entries in Link and Reveal as they relate to lodging, meals, GMR, and airfare booking requests
- Serve as the Member's personal "Travel Agent," booking travel accommodations, relaying itineraries, changes, delays, and cancellations with Member, case manager or social worker
- Create transportation requests, as needed, for travel accommodations to and from airport/appointment/hotel
- Per plan requirements, compare cost effectiveness of charitable housing vs traditional lodging
- Ensure accuracy when entering data into the appropriate systems (Link, Reveal, etc.)
- Ensure all pertinent documentation is saved in the appropriate health plan folder(s)
- Regular attendance is required
- Other duties as assigned
